Joleon Lescott says no to Rangers move - reports

Joleon Lescott has decided against a move to Rangers following talks with the club.

Lescott visited Glasgow but it is understood he has told manager Mark Warburton that he does not want to move to Scotland for family reasons.

The 34-year-old, who has a young family, was available on a free transfer with Aston Villa prepared to pay a portion of his final year’s salary. The former Everton player has also been linked with a move to David Moyes’ Sunderland.

Warburton could now turn to Philippe Senderos in his search for a fourth centre-back. The 31-year-old former Arsenal defender is a free agent and has been training with the club this week.

Rangers are still on course to sign Preston striker Joe Garner in a £1.5million deal, but it is unlikely to be completed before Saturday’s Ladbrokes Premiership clash with Motherwell.
